again yes thats true that you can mig weld aluminum, but making it pretty is really tough and takes alot of practice, i spent a bunch of money on my spool gun and argon tank and teflon liner only to make a birdsnest everytime. again not that its not doable, but the home guy probably won't. not to mention you cant do aluminum with a 110V mig. you need at least a 220 v mig so you can get enough heat into the aluminum being welded.
